Sanctions Risks in Stablecoin Payments
Common Sanctions Threats in Digital Payments
Stablecoin transactions come with their fair share of sanctions-related risks. One of the most pressing concerns is the potential for direct transactions with sanctioned entities - such as wallets or individuals listed on databases like OFAC's Specially Designated Nationals (SDN) List. Under U.S. primary sanctions, even a single transaction involving an SDN-listed address can result in strict liability. This means companies are held accountable, even if the violation was unintentional.
Another challenge arises from compromised funds. Stablecoins like USDC or USDT have transparent transaction histories, making them easy to trace. If funds in a wallet are linked to sanctioned individuals, mixers like Tornado Cash (sanctioned in August 2022), or other illicit activities, regulators can follow the blockchain trail. Transfers involving such tainted funds - whether they passed through sanctioned mixers or addresses tied to SDN entities - can lead to penalties.
High-risk jurisdictions further complicate matters. Sanctioned actors frequently use regions such as Russia, Iran, North Korea, Cuba, Sudan, and Syria to obscure the flow of funds. From late 2023 to 2025, enforcement of cryptocurrency-related sanctions reached unprecedented levels. Warning signs include transactions originating from IP addresses in sanctioned countries, connections to known mixers, or unusual patterns involving new wallet addresses. These risks make it clear that robust compliance measures are not optional - they’re essential.
Why Stablecoins Need Extra Compliance Measures
The risks tied to stablecoin payments highlight the need for enhanced compliance protocols. Unlike traditional wire transfers, which are subject to intermediary compliance checks at banks, stablecoin transactions settle instantly and bypass these safeguards. Once a payment is executed on-chain, it’s irreversible, yet regulators still hold companies accountable for any violations. Without pre-transaction screening, businesses are left exposed to significant regulatory risks.
Adding to the complexity, the pseudonymous nature of blockchain technology conceals the identities behind wallet addresses. Cross-chain bridges further exacerbate the problem by enabling funds to move across multiple networks, making enforcement even tougher. To mitigate these challenges, companies must take proactive steps. This includes independently screening wallet histories for any signs of compromised funds before completing a transaction, rather than relying on intermediaries to handle compliance.

How Pre-Transaction Controls Screen Stablecoin Payments Before Execution
Pre-transaction controls step in to screen payments before they’re finalized, ensuring compliance with sanctions regulations. Unlike traditional banking systems - where compliance checks happen during intermediary processing - stablecoin transactions settle instantly and irreversibly on-chain. This means companies must proactively verify, at the intent stage, that funds won’t end up with sanctioned entities.
Here’s how it works: automated checks are inserted between the decision to pay and the signing phase. Once the finance team creates a payment intent, specialized agents screen recipient wallets against the OFAC SDN List, review transaction histories for potential exposure, and enforce predefined policies. If a red flag pops up - like a wallet associated with sanctioned regions such as Iran or Russia, or funds linked to Tornado Cash - the system blocks the transaction before it’s signed.
This preventive approach played a crucial role during enforcement surges from late 2023 to 2025, when sanctions violations in cryptocurrency transactions reached new heights. By catching and halting prohibited payments early, these controls help companies steer clear of violations altogether. Agent-Driven Checks Before Signing
Automated agents conduct real-time checks before any transaction gets the green light. These agents compare recipient wallet addresses against SDN and PEP watchlists while tracing wallet histories for links to sanctioned entities or mixers. Advanced anomaly detection also flags unusual activity - like payments at odd hours, amounts that deviate significantly from normal patterns, or transfers to newly created addresses.
For example, Stablerail’s agents handle these checks on MPC wallets for corporate treasury for stablecoins like USDC and USDT on EVM chains, including Ethereum and Base. The system generates a Risk Dossier with a verdict: PASS, FLAG, or BLOCK. This dossier includes clear evidence, such as timestamps, policy references, or blockchain data. For instance, a $7,500 payment to a new vendor might trigger a FLAG because it exceeds the $5,000 limit requiring CFO approval.
Importantly, these agents don’t operate in isolation. Stablerail doesn’t have unilateral signing authority and can’t move funds independently. This “copilot, not autopilot” approach ensures automated screening works alongside human oversight, catching risks that manual reviews might overlook. Enforcing Financial Policies Through Code
Policy-as-code takes manual financial rules and turns them into automated controls that apply to every payment intent. Companies can set specific rules, like “payments over $5,000 to new addresses require CFO approval” or “weekend transfers exceeding $10,000 need additional verification.” These rules are then enforced automatically before any transaction is signed, reducing human error and ensuring compliance.
The process integrates smoothly with existing workflows. Finance teams can upload an invoice, a payout CSV, or use an API to create a payment intent. From there, agents apply the pre-defined rules, generating a Risk Dossier for review. If a flag arises, approvers can override it, but they must provide documented reasons. The system keeps a complete audit trail - from intent creation to checks, overrides, and approvals - offering CFO-grade evidence for auditors and regulators. This setup mirrors the governance standards of traditional bank wires while maintaining the speed and efficiency of on-chain transactions.

FAQs
What counts as “tainted” stablecoin funds?
“Tainted” stablecoin funds refer to assets associated with activities such as mixers, cross-chain swaps, or wallets flagged on sanctions lists. These funds carry compliance risks and demand careful screening to minimize the risk of sanctions violations.
How do pre-transaction controls avoid false positives?
Pre-transaction controls help cut down on false positives by applying multiple layers of verification. These include sanctions screening, behavioral anomaly detection, and policy enforcement. Each layer checks for things like counterparty risk, unusual transaction patterns, and compliance with regulations, offering clear, easy-to-understand explanations backed by solid evidence.
To ensure accuracy, these systems combine machine-enforceable policies with human-in-the-loop approvals. This approach balances automation with human oversight, making sure only legitimate transactions go through while keeping errors and compliance issues in check.
